The latter listens 24/7, analyzing recordings using machine learning to identify bird calls and sounds.Merlin Bird ID helps you identify birds you see and hear. Merlin is unlike any other bird app—it's powered by eBird, the world’s largest database of bird sightings, sounds, and photos. Merlin offers four fun ways to identify birds. Answer a few simple questions, upload a photo, record a singing bird, or explore birds in a region.The Birdly app is not just a bird book on your phone, it is Australia’s first bird identification guide specifically designed and built as an app only. The recommended method is as follows:White-throated Sparrow — Old Sam Peabody Peabody Peabody! Olive-sided Flycatcher — Quick three beers! Eastern Towhee — Drink your tea! Warbling Vireo — I’ll see you and I’ll seize you and I’ll squeeze you ’til you squirt! Follow the links to hear what each bird really sounds like. These include the Audubon Bird Call Identifier, Distinctive Bird Calls, and identifying birds by picture.The BirdNET app, a free machine-learning powered tool that can identify over 3,000 birds by sound alone, generates reliable scientific data and makes it easier for people to contribute citizen ...Birds make contact calls to keep in touch with each other, often while they’re foraging for food. These sounds are usually short, quick, and quiet, though if birds get separated, they may make louder, more urgent “separation calls.”. Flight calls.

Bird have high interspecies variance - same bird species singing in different countries might sound …What BirdNET-Pi Does. 24/7 recording and automatic identification of bird songs, chirps, and peeps using BirdNET machine learning. Automatic extraction and cataloguing of bird clips from full-length recordings. Tools to visualize your recorded bird data and analyze trends. A free app available for Android and iOS users, BirdNET is the brainchild of a collaboration between the Cornell Lab of Ornithology and Chemnitz University of Technology.
